writel() 往内存映射的 I/O 空间上写数据,wirtel()   I/O 上写入 32 位数据 (4字节)。原型:
#include <asm/io.h>
void writel (unsigned char data , unsigned short addr )
readl() 从内存映射的 I/O 空间读取数据,readl 从 I/O 读取 32 位数据 ( 4 字节 )。
原型:
#include <asm/io.h>
unsigned char readl (unsigned int addr )
注:变量    addr  是 I/O 地址。
返回值 : 从 I/O 空间读取的数值。

linux中readl()和writel()函数---用于读写寄存器相关推荐

  1. linux内核中linux中readl()和writel()函数---用于读写寄存器

    现在在一些arm高级一点的处理器上配置寄存器的方式其实就是直接访问寄存器地址,可以简单的写成*(uint32_t *)(addr) = val.也可以通过readl()函数和writel()函数对一些 ...

  2. c语言open函数打开文件方式,Linux中C语言open函数打开或创建文件详细讲解

    Linux中C语言open函数打开或创建文件详细讲解 Linux中C语言open函数打开或创建文件详细讲解 头文件: #include #include #include 函数原型: int open ...

  3. 转:linux中fork()函数详解

    转:linux中fork()函数详解 https://blog.csdn.net/jason314/article/details/5640969 转载于:https://www.cnblogs.co ...

  4. 在linux下面实现检测按键(Linux中kbhit()函数的实现)

    //在linux下面实现检测按键(Linux中kbhit()函数的实现) #include <stdio.h> #include <termios.h> #include &l ...

  5. linux之getcwd函数解析,Linux 中C语言getcwd()函数的用法

    Linux 中C语言getcwd()函数的用法 先来看该函数的声明: #include char *getcwd(char *buf,size_t size); 介绍: 参数说明:getcwd()会将 ...

  6. linux下面实现检测按键(Linux中kbhit()函数的实现)

    在linux下面实现检测按键(Linux中kbhit()函数的实现)   #include <stdio.h> #include <termios.h> #include &l ...

  7. linux kbhit扫描键盘,(转)检测按键(Linux中kbhit()函数的实现)

    http://hi.baidu.com/jtntiivtemcnsue/item/90689ce172ee912c5a7cfb1b 编写过MS-DOS程序的人通常都会查找Linux下等同于kbhit的 ...

  8. linux中c语言kbhit函数用法,检测按键(Linux中kbhit()函数的实现)

    编写过MS-DOS程序的人通常都会查找Linux下等同于kbhit的函数,这个函数会检测一个按键是否被按下而并不实际的读取.不幸的是他们并没有找到这样的函数,因为并没有直接等同的函数.Unix程序员并 ...

  9. Linux中的进程创建函数fork

    为什么80%的码农都做不了架构师?>>>    Linux中的进程通过fork创建,并通过exec执行,分为两步. 在Linux中所有的进程都是pid为1的init进程的子进程,内核 ...

最新文章

  1. 日志——Vue.js开发在线简历生成器
  2. 智能视觉组参赛总结及体会- 西安邮电大学 - AI小布丁
  3. 祝「杭州程序媛」母亲节快乐!
  4. 「CTSC2018」假面
  5. javascript闭包-全局变量与局部变量
  6. CTFshow 命令执行 web54
  7. decimal函数python_decimal数据类型
  8. 成功解决AttributeError: type object 'scipy.interpolate.interpnd.array' has no attribute '__reduce_cython
  9. Oracle分组取出每组的第一笔数据
  10. 分享几个亲测有效的高效工作技巧
  11. 为什么要进行归一化处理?(从寻找最优解这个角度讨论)
  12. web command line : http://yubnub.org/
  13. sv_labs学习笔记——sv_lab2(System Verilog)
  14. 获取iframe子页面节点,响应浏览器宽高
  15. 用ping IP的方法测试网卡
  16. java 打开scv 文件_JAVA读写CSV文件
  17. 模型预测控制参数调整问题
  18. voc2007,voc2012数据集快速下载方法
  19. selenium-对指定区域截图
  20. java中string是什么意思_java中string什么意思

热门文章

  1. 博客中最快捷的公式显示方式:Mathjax + Lyx
  2. 变换判断滤波器类型_7.4 低通IIR滤波器的频率变换
  3. tomcat startup启动不起来 但也不报错_Resin 与 Tomcat 服务器对比
  4. @scheduled cron动态修改_spring boot实现动态增删启停定时任务
  5. python 多态 协议详解
  6. 开源Jekyll助您构建你的网站
  7. 单片机外包公司可以去吗?学好单片机能接私活吗?
  8. 单片机初学者做项目为什么这么难?单片机初学者心得有哪些
  9. 关于学习Python的一点学习总结(23->while语句与else)
  10. poj1410(线段相交问题判断)